Mara Bratoš Opens 'Lopud Portraits' Exhibition at Sponza Palace for Dubrovnik Summer Festival

At the very start of the jubilee festival season, the audience can look forward to an exhibition by our renowned photographer Mara Bratoš, titled "Lopud Portraits." The opening of the exhibition will take place in the atrium of Sponza Palace on Friday, July 12, at 9 PM.

Although she is a photographer based in Zagreb, Mara Bratoš invariably spends her summers in the south where she grew up, and where her talent was recognized and nurtured amidst the reflections of the sun, sea, and camera lens. The presented series of photographs frame the years from 1998 to 2024. In them, we recognize the signature style of the photographer, who, through her work, captures the small histories of people and migrations, as well as the absence of people on the islands, demonstrated by abandoned buildings, narrating tales of abandoned dreams and fears of those who once lived there.

The selected photographs also depict the everyday lives of young couples, girls, and boys with big dreams, and the nurturing moments of children and parents, which have a special significance in forming relationships among island families.

The common denominator among the portrayed subjects is their relaxed presence, framed by the well-known context of the island, which becomes their living space, whether it’s being photographed in the blazing summer sun or in the deep shade of the mystical Đorđić-Mayneri garden.

Mara Bratoš’s photographs, much like the island women, open their diaries to the observer and tell their life stories that are simultaneously gentle and harsh, loud and quiet, present and absent, like the summers themselves, whose memories shape our identities.

After the opening, the exhibition will be on display in the atrium of Sponza Palace until August 1, 2024.
